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ized coatings or sealants to the exterior or interior surfaces of a building’s foundation. The primary goal is to create a protective barrier that prevents water infiltration, reduces moisture penetration, and minimizes the risk of damage caused by environmental elements. These services typically include surface preparation, such as cleaning and repairing existing cracks, followed by the application of sealants designed to adhere effectively to concrete surfaces. Proper sealing can help extend the lifespan of a foundation by maintaining its structural integrity and reducing the need for costly repairs over time.

One of the main problems addressed by foundation sealing is water intrusion, which can lead to issues like basement flooding, mold growth, and deterioration of the concrete itself. Excess moisture can weaken the foundation over time, causing cracks, shifting, or settling that compromise the stability of the entire structure. Sealing services are especially valuable in areas prone to heavy rainfall, snowmelt, or high humidity. By creating a moisture-resistant barrier, these services help protect the property from water-related damages and improve indoor air quality by reducing mold and mildew growth caused by excess humidity.

Cost Range for Sealing - The typical cost for concrete foundation sealing services varies based on the size and condition of the foundation. Prices generally range from $500 to $2,500 for standard residential projects. Larger or more complex foundations may cost more, depending on scope.

Factors Influencing Price - Costs can fluctuate depending on the type of sealing material used and the extent of surface preparation required. For example, basic sealant application might be around $1,000, while waterproof coatings could reach $3,000 or more.

Average Cost per Square Foot - Many contractors charge between $3 and $8 per square foot for sealing a concrete foundation. For a typical basement foundation of 1,000 square feet, this could translate to approximately $3,000 to $8,000.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include surface repairs, crack sealing, or moisture barrier installation. These additional services can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ars to the overall project cost, depending on the work needed.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Why is sealing a concrete foundation important? Sealing helps protect the foundation from moisture intrusion, reducing the risk of cracks, mold, and structural damage caused by water penetration.

How often should a concrete foundation be sealed? The frequency of sealing depends on the local climate and conditions, but typically, it is recommended every 2 to 5 years to maintain optimal protection.

What types of sealants are used for foundation sealing? Common sealants include penetrating sealers, elastomeric coatings, and waterproofing membranes, selected based on the specific needs of the foundation.

Can foundation sealing fix existing cracks or damage? Sealing can help prevent further water infiltration but may not repair existing structural cracks; repairs should be evaluated by a professional contractor.
